One of the key features of KanBo is its card details section. This section is used to describe the card’s purpose and character and to give information about other related cards, users, and time dependencies. The left section of the card details is informational in nature, and it is where you can control the workflow of the card.

With KanBo, you can easily modify card details from the card level. This makes it easy to change the status of the card, change the card list, add users to the card, add and remove labels, add card dates and set reminders, and add relations with any existing card or create a new related one. The quick actions menu also makes it easy to make card detail modifications.

The visibility of card details can be adjusted from the board level using the Display Settings. This means that you can add or remove card details as and when required.

Did you know that KanBo is much more than just a tool for task management? It is a complete work coordination platform that can streamline all the work-related activities in your organization. Apart from task management, KanBo offers a wide range of features that can help teams collaborate in a more efficient and effective way.

For example, KanBo Workspaces allow teams to create a centralized hub for all their work-related activities. With Workspaces, teams can stay organized and collaborate with ease, as all the relevant information is available in one place. KanBo also supports multiple Document Sources in Spaces, which means teams can integrate documents from various sources, such as SharePoint or Google Drive.

The powerful card system in KanBo allows teams to break down complex tasks into manageable chunks. Here, teams can assign people to cards, set due dates, add notes, checklists, and even block cards if they are facing any issues. The Card Relations feature in KanBo enables teams to create dependencies between cards, ensuring that every task can be completed in the right order.

KanBo’s visualization features can help teams understand their work progress in a better way. The Kanban view provides an overview of all the tasks in-progress, the List view allows users to view tasks in a more structured manner, and the Gantt chart view helps teams to understand how the tasks are related to each other and what is the overall timeline.

KanBo also supports dashboards, reports, and resource management features that can help teams to manage their work in a more informed way. With these features, team leads can track task completion, monitor resource utilization, and make data-driven decisions in real-time.
